Product reviews:
Nathan
2026-03-03 iphone 11 Pro Max
Mall of Africa - SKECHERS Now Open at skechers factory shop south africa
skechers factory shop south africa
Tobias
2026-02-27 iphone 6s Plus
SKECHERS Official Site | Comfort That skechers factory shop south africa
skechers factory shop south africa
International Retail \u0026 Franchising skechers factory shop south africa
skechers factory shop south africa
Skechers expands footprint in London to skechers factory shop south africa
skechers factory shop south africa